a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/debugger/debuggerplugin.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/plugins/debugger/debuggerplugin.cpp')
-rw-r--r--src/plugins/debugger/debuggerplugin.cpp12
1 files changed, 7 insertions, 5 deletions
diff --git a/src/plugins/debugger/debuggerplugin.cpp b/src/plugins/debugger/debuggerplugin.cpp
index cc7c1fba25..5fd844d83d 100644
--- a/src/plugins/debugger/debuggerplugin.cpp
+++ b/src/plugins/debugger/debuggerplugin.cpp
@@ -547,6 +547,8 @@ public:
mainWindow->addSubPerspectiveSwitcher(EngineManager::engineChooser());
setWidget(splitter);
+
+ setMenu(DebuggerMainWindow::perspectiveMenu());
}
~DebugMode() { delete widget(); }
@@ -1749,7 +1751,7 @@ void DebuggerPlugin::getEnginesState(QByteArray *json) const
void DebuggerPluginPrivate::attachToQmlPort()
{
- AttachToQmlPortDialog dlg(ICore::mainWindow());
+ AttachToQmlPortDialog dlg(ICore::dialogParent());
const QVariant qmlServerPort = configValue("LastQmlServerPort");
if (qmlServerPort.isValid())
@@ -1954,7 +1956,7 @@ void DebuggerPluginPrivate::dumpLog()
LogWindow *logWindow = engine->logWindow();
QTC_ASSERT(logWindow, return);
- QString fileName = QFileDialog::getSaveFileName(ICore::mainWindow(),
+ QString fileName = QFileDialog::getSaveFileName(ICore::dialogParent(),
tr("Save Debugger Log"), Utils::TemporaryDirectory::masterDirectoryPath());
if (fileName.isEmpty())
return;
@@ -1966,7 +1968,7 @@ void DebuggerPluginPrivate::dumpLog()
ts << logWindow->combinedContents();
saver.setResult(&ts);
}
- saver.finalize(ICore::mainWindow());
+ saver.finalize(ICore::dialogParent());
}
void DebuggerPluginPrivate::aboutToShutdown()
@@ -2186,7 +2188,7 @@ static BuildConfiguration::BuildType startupBuildType()
void showCannotStartDialog(const QString &text)
{
- auto errorDialog = new QMessageBox(ICore::mainWindow());
+ auto errorDialog = new QMessageBox(ICore::dialogParent());
errorDialog->setAttribute(Qt::WA_DeleteOnClose);
errorDialog->setIcon(QMessageBox::Warning);
errorDialog->setWindowTitle(text);
@@ -2251,7 +2253,7 @@ bool wantRunTool(ToolMode toolMode, const QString &toolName)
"or otherwise insufficient output.</p><p>"
"Do you want to continue and run the tool in %2 mode?</p></body></html>")
.arg(toolName).arg(currentMode).arg(toolModeString);
- if (Utils::CheckableMessageBox::doNotAskAgainQuestion(ICore::mainWindow(),
+ if (Utils::CheckableMessageBox::doNotAskAgainQuestion(ICore::dialogParent(),
title, message, ICore::settings(), "AnalyzerCorrectModeWarning")
!= QDialogButtonBox::Yes)
return false;